UPDATE: (Apparently 'Badger' was no ordinary bus rider who simply snapped.)

TORONTO - A police officer at the scene of a fatal stabbing on a Canadian bus reported seeing the attacker hacking off pieces of the victim's body and eating them, according to a police tape leaked on the Internet Saturday.

In the tape of radio transmissions, officers referred to the attacker, who also beheaded the victim, as "Badger." They said he was armed with a knife and scissors and was "defiling the body."

"Badger's at the back of the bus, hacking off pieces and eating it," an officer with the Royal Canadian Mounted Police said on the tape.

The RCMP described the tapes as "operational police communications and, as such, are not meant for public consumption." The tape was posted on YouTube among other Web sites.

Here's what was in this morning's Edmonton Journal:

The "accused" is Vince Weiguang Li, age 40. He worked as an independent newspaper delivery man for the Edmonton Journal, delivering the paper in the Clareview area (my neck of the woods in Edmonton).

His supervisor said he was a "nice guy" and a reliable worker. Monday Vince delivered the paper and after Tuesday, his supervisor didn't hear from him. The story goes on to say that he was married and he and his wife may have been having marital problems. His neighbors from his apartment building were interviewed and they said he was unfriendly and antisocial. He was apparently often seen at late hours of evening in the parking lot of the apartment complex walking around.

I think the news said earlier he had no prior history with police.

On another note, the victim was in Edmonton working the Capital Ex (akin to a county fair) and was heading home after it ended its stay in town.

So sad for this family. :(

The Crown has decided to pursue a 2nd degree murder charge rather than first. They're not certain they could get a 1st degree because they may not be able to prove premeditation.
